NEVER SERVE VISIBLY INTOXICATED PEOPLE

Visible intoxication: a perceptible act or series of actions, including behavioral changes that present a clear sign of intoxication; swaying, staggering, slurred speech, loud boisterous inappropriate behavior.

• “Visible Intoxication” may not be apparent until the person has a BAC of .1 - .15!
•Legal Intoxication is .05
•DWAI is .05 - .07
•A DUI is .08 or higher
•When you see “visible signs” of intoxication, you should be concerned.
